Yintoni umahluko phakathi kwe-HPMC kunye ne-MC

I-MC yi-methyl cellulose, efumaneka ngokunyanga umqhaphu ocoliweyo nge-alkali, kusetyenziswa i-methyl chloride njenge-ether etherifying, kwaye kwenziwe i-cellulose ether ngothotho lweempendulo. Ngokubanzi, inqanaba lokutshintshwa yi-1.6 ~ 2.0, kwaye ukunyibilika nako kwahlukile ngeqondo lokutshintshwa kwamanqanaba ahlukeneyo. Ixhomekeke kwi-non-ionic cellulose ether.

(1) Ukugcinwa kwamanzii-methyl cellulosekuxhomekeke kubungakanani bayo bokongeza, ukuxinana, ukucoleka kwamasuntswana kunye nesantya sokunyibilika. Ngokubanzi, ukuba ubungakanani bokongeza bukhulu, ukucoleka buncinci, kwaye ukucoleka kukhulu, izinga lokugcina amanzi liphezulu. Phakathi kwazo, ubungakanani bokongeza bunempembelelo enkulu kwisantya sokugcina amanzi, kwaye inqanaba lokucoleka alilingani nenqanaba lokugcinwa kwamanzi. Isantya sokunyibilika sixhomekeke kakhulu kwinqanaba lokuguqulwa komphezulu wamasuntswana e-cellulose kunye nokucoleka kwamasuntswana. Phakathi kwee-ethers ze-cellulose ezingentla, i-methyl cellulose kunye ne-hydroxypropyl methyl cellulose zinamazinga aphezulu okugcinwa kwamanzi.

(2) I-Methylcellulose iyanyibilika emanzini abandayo, kodwa kunzima ukuyinyibilikisa emanzini ashushu, kwaye isisombululo sayo samanzi sizinzile kakhulu kuluhlu lwe-pH=3~12. Ihambelana kakuhle nesitatshi, i-guar gum, njl.njl. kunye nezinye izinto ezininzi ezibangela ukuba i-surfactants ifikelele kubushushu be-gelation, kwenzeka into yokuba i-gelation ivele.

(3) Utshintsho lobushushu luya kuchaphazela kakhulu izinga lokugcina amanzi le-methyl cellulose. Ngokubanzi, xa ubushushu buphezulu, kokukhona ukugcinwa kwamanzi kuba kubi. Ukuba ubushushu be-mortar budlula ama-40 °C, ukugcinwa kwamanzi kwe-methyl cellulose kuya kuba kubi kakhulu, nto leyo eya kuchaphazela kakhulu ukusebenza kakuhle kwe-mortar.

(4) I-Methyl cellulose inefuthe elikhulu ekusebenzeni nasekunamatheleni kwe-mortar. Igama elithi “Adhesion” apha libhekisa ekunamatheleni okuvakalayo phakathi kwesixhobo sokufaka isicelo somsebenzi kunye ne-substrate yodonga, oko kukuthi, ukumelana nokucheba kwe-mortar. Ukunamathela kukhulu, ukumelana nokucheba kwe-mortar kukhulu, kwaye amandla afunekayo ngabasebenzi kwinkqubo yokusebenzisa nawo makhulu, kwaye ukwakhiwa kwe-mortar kuphantsi. Ukunamathela kwe-Methylcellulose kukwinqanaba eliphakathi kwiimveliso ze-cellulose ether.

I-HPMC yi-hydroxypropyl methyl cellulose, eyi-ether exutyiweyo ye-non-ionic cellulose eyenziwe ngekotoni ecociweyo emva konyango lwe-alkali, kusetyenziswa i-propylene oxide kunye ne-methyl chloride njengee-ethers ezitshisayo, kwaye ngokusebenzisa uthotho lweempendulo. Umlinganiselo wokutshintshwa ngokubanzi yi-1.2 ukuya kwi-2.0. Iimpawu zayo ziyahluka ngokuxhomekeke kumlinganiselo womxholo we-methoxyl kunye nomxholo we-hydroxypropyl.

(1) I-Hydroxypropyl methylcellulose inyibilika lula emanzini abandayo, kodwa iya kujongana nobunzima ekunyibilikeni emanzini ashushu. Kodwa ubushushu bayo be-gelation emanzini ashushu buphezulu kakhulu kunobo be-methyl cellulose. Ukunyibilika emanzini abandayo kuphucuke kakhulu xa kuthelekiswa ne-methyl cellulose.

(2) Ubunzima be-hydroxypropyl methylcellulose bunxulumene nobukhulu bobunzima bayo beemolekyuli, kwaye okukhona ubunzima be-molekyuli bukhulu, kokukhona ubuninzi be-viscosity buphezulu. Ubushushu bukwachaphazela ubushushu bayo, njengoko ubushushu busanda, ubuninzi be-viscosity buyehla. Kodwa ubuninzi be-viscosity abuchaphazeleki kakhulu bubushushu obuphezulu kune-methyl cellulose. Isisombululo sayo sizinzile xa sigcinwa kubushushu begumbi.

(3) I-Hydroxypropyl methylcellulose izinzile kwi-asidi kunye ne-alkali, kwaye isisombululo sayo samanzi sizinzile kakhulu kuluhlu lwe-pH=2~12. I-Caustic soda kunye namanzi ekalika azinampembelelo ingako ekusebenzeni kwayo, kodwa i-alkali inokukhawulezisa ukunyibilika kwayo kwaye yonyuse i-viscosity. I-Hydroxypropyl methylcellulose izinzile kwi-viscosity eqhelekileyo, kodwa xa uxinzelelo lwe-viscosity ye-hydroxypropyl methylcellulose luphezulu, i-viscosity yesisombululo se-hydroxypropyl methylcellulose idla ngokwanda.

(4) Ukugcinwa kwamanzii-hydroxypropyl methylcellulosekuxhomekeke kubungakanani bayo bokongeza, i-viscosity, njl. Izinga lokugcina amanzi phantsi kobungakanani obufanayo bokongeza liphezulu kunele-methyl cellulose.

(5) I-hydroxypropyl methylcellulose ingaxutywa nee-polymer compounds ezinyibilikayo emanzini ukuze zenze isisombululo esinobungqingili obufanayo nobuphezulu. Ezifana ne-polyvinyl alcohol, i-starch ether, i-vegetable gum, njl.

(6) Ukunamathela kwe-hydroxypropyl methylcellulose kulwakhiwo lwe-mortar kuphezulu kunoko kwe-methylcellulose.

(7) I-hydroxypropyl methylcellulose inokumelana ngcono nee-enzymes kune-methylcellulose, kwaye ithuba layo lokubola kwe-enzymatic solution liphantsi kunele-methylcellulose.
